#A398E2 Color
#A398E2 is rgb(163, 152, 226) in RGB, hsl(249, 56%, 74%) in HSL, and about cmyk(28%, 33%, 0%, 11%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Light Pastel Purple (#B19CD9), clearly related but distinguishable side by side at ΔE 8.31. Black text is the more readable choice on this background.

#A398E2 Channel Values
How #A398E2 bre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 163 · G 152 · B 226 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 249° · S 56% · L 74%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 249° · S 33% · V 89%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 28% · M 33% · Y 0% · K 11%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 2.58:1 vs white · 8.15: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|
Text Contrast & Accessibility
W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#A398E2 background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

#A398E2 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#A398E2?
#A398E2 is a light blue — rgb(163, 152, 226) in RGB and hsl(249, 56%, 74%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Light Pastel Purple (#B19CD9), which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side at a CIE76 distance of 8.31.
What is the RGB value of #A398E2?
#A398E2 is rgb(163, 152, 226) — red 163, green 152, and blue 226 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#A398E2?
#A398E2 converts to approximately cmyk(28%, 33%, 0%, 11%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#A398E2 be black or white?
Black text is the more readable choice. #A398E2 scores 2.58:1 against white and 8.15: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#A398E2 as a CSS color keyword?
No. #A398E2 is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is cornflowerblue (#6495ED) at a CIE76 distance of 19.73, which is visibly different.
